Buffalo invented the wing (Anchor Bar, 1964, midnight, blue cheese, celery, not negotiable) and that should tell you most of what you need to know about the city's spirit. The Bills Mafia jumps through tables in subzero parking lots. Niagara Falls is 20 minutes away. The architecture (Sullivan, Wright, Olmsted parks) is genuinely world-class. The snow is part of the local mythology and the locals wear it proudly.
